Output 58ced32271c38c8df65933ab2d2943e46f013821f46e08e7586ae82a22745845:1

value
10915914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256742d1277c883eb9546134af36f08f811340ff OP_EQUAL
address
356ndLn7gcpQxhfudEF1bo9TCiVoqjW4nc
transaction
58ced32271c38c8df65933ab2d2943e46f013821f46e08e7586ae82a22745845
confirmations
444714
spent
true